Automation Is Not the Enemy — Your Timing Is


Listen Later

Automation gets a bad rap. “Too impersonal,” “feels cold,” “nobody wants to talk to a robot.”
But in this myth-busting episode of Booked from the Dead, Mason and Jay expose what’s really turning leads off — and it’s not automation. It’s bad timing.
Jay brings up a few cringe-worthy examples of mistimed automations, while Mason breaks down why the same message — sent at the right time — can feel helpful, even human. You’ll hear how a single reactivation SMS pulled in 11% bookings just by hitting inboxes before the day got noisy.
They also walk through how to design timing-based logic around service cycles, peak reply hours, and buyer intent — no new tech needed.
This episode will shift how you think about “human touch” in your sales funnel — and show you how automation done right creates better conversations, not worse ones.
